The Book of Talaq (Divorces)/Divorce of People with Mental Condition and Insane Ones and their Guardian#6

No. ٦chapter #6vol. 6 · page 126
alkafi-10895

عَلِيُّ بْنُ إِبْرَاهِيمَ عَنْ أَبِيهِ عَنِ النَّوْفَلِيِّ عَنِ السَّكُونِيِّ عَنْ أَبِي عَبْدِ اللَّهِ ع قَالَ:

Show clickable narrator chain

كُلُّ طَلَاقٍ جَائِزٌ إِلَّا طَلَاقَ الْمَعْتُوهِ أَوِ الصَّبِيِّ أَوْ مُبَرْسَمٍ أَوْ مَجْنُونٍ أَوْ مَكْرُوهٍ‌.

Read English translationMuhammad Sarwar — attributed by Thaqalayn

6. Ali ibn Ibrahim has narrated from his father from al-Nawfaliy from al-Sakuniy who has said the following: “Abu ‘Abd Allah (a.s.), has said, ‘Divorce is permissible except divorce by a man with mental condition, a child or Mubarsam, (suffering from a disease of diaphragm), an insane or a coerced one.”’

Translation: Muhammad Sarwar — attributed by Thaqalayn·The Arabic above is the original.

Hadith gradings

1
  • ضعيف على المشهورAllamah Baqir al-MajlisiMirʾāt al-ʿUqūl fī Sharḥ Akhbār Āl al-Rasūl (21/213)
الهوامش · 1

[1]البرسام: هو التهاب في الحجاب الذي بين الكبد و القلب.ص 126
